The Global Incubator Gloves Market was valued at USD 712 million in 2023 and is projected to reach USD 1.09 billion by 2031, expanding at a CAGR of 5.5% during the forecast period from 2023 to 2031. This market is driven by the increasing demand for contamination-free laboratory environments, rising biotechnology and pharmaceutical R&D activities, and the growth of high-precision medical applications that require sterile handling of sensitive materials. Incubator gloves—integral to glove boxes and isolators—are essential for maintaining sterile conditions in applications such as cell culture, drug development, and electronics manufacturing.
Drivers:
1. Growth in Biotechnology and Pharmaceutical
Research
With a rise in R&D spending in drug
discovery, vaccine development, and genetic engineering, the demand for
incubator gloves has significantly increased. These gloves ensure
contamination-free environments crucial for sensitive biological experiments.
2. Stringent Safety and Contamination
Control Norms
Global regulations and best practices in
laboratory and pharmaceutical operations mandate high levels of hygiene and
contamination control, driving widespread adoption of incubator gloves in
cleanroom setups and controlled environments.
3. Increasing Demand in Semiconductor and
Electronics Industry
In addition to healthcare, the precision
manufacturing processes in semiconductors and electronics—where even
microscopic contamination can ruin entire batches—are boosting the demand for
high-performance glove box gloves.
Restraints:
1. High Cost of High-Performance Glove
Materials
Premium materials such as CSM
(Chlorosulfonated Polyethylene), Neoprene, and Butyl rubber are essential for
certain high-risk environments but come at a higher cost, limiting adoption in
cost-sensitive settings.
2. Limited Reusability and Risk of
Punctures
While these gloves offer sterility and
protection, they are prone to wear and tear over time. Frequent replacement due
to perforations or degradation can increase operational costs.
Opportunity:
1. Rising Adoption in Emerging Markets
Countries in Asia-Pacific and Latin America
are significantly investing in biotechnology infrastructure and laboratory
facilities, creating new demand for sterile containment systems, including
incubator gloves.
2. Innovation in Glove Materials and
Ergonomic Designs
Research into new synthetic polymers and
multilayered glove systems is enhancing durability, chemical resistance, and
user comfort, opening doors for innovation-driven market growth.
3. Expanding Applications in Nuclear and
Defense Research
The use of glove boxes in nuclear materials
handling and defense research for high-sensitivity samples is expanding,
presenting niche but lucrative opportunities for market players.
Market
by System Type Insights:
The market is segmented into Butyl Rubber
Gloves, Hypalon (CSM) Gloves, Natural Latex Gloves, and Neoprene Gloves. In
2023, Butyl Rubber Gloves accounted for the largest share owing to their
superior chemical resistance and low permeability. They are extensively used in
pharmaceutical isolators and hazardous materials handling. However, the Hypalon
Gloves segment is expected to witness the fastest growth due to rising demand
in sterile applications across life sciences and electronics.

Key
Market Developments:
2023: Piercan SAS launched a new range of
multilayer CSM gloves designed for enhanced mechanical strength and chemical
resistance, targeting biotech cleanrooms.
2024: Ansell Limited introduced
antimicrobial incubator gloves with built-in puncture detection layers, aimed
at pharmaceutical isolators.
2025: Renco Corporation expanded its
production capacity in Southeast Asia to meet the growing regional demand for
sterile containment gloves.
